Course structure

• Introduction to AI in Radiation Oncology
• Advanced Machine Learning for Medical Imaging
• AI-Driven Treatment Planning Techniques
• Radiation Therapy Optimization with AI
• Clinical Applications of AI in Oncology
• Ethical and Regulatory Considerations in AI-Driven Healthcare
• Data Management and Integration for Oncology AI Systems
• Predictive Modeling for Patient Outcomes in Radiation Oncology
• Real-Time AI Applications in Radiation Delivery
• Emerging Trends and Innovations in AI for Oncology
